Baker furnitures history can be traced back to the late 1800s when Siebe Baker relocated from the Netherlands to Michigan and founded his first company, one that specialised in interior woodwork. Though the Baker family sold the in 1929, the company went into bankruptcy in 1934 and Hollis Baker, son of the companys founder, bought the company back, acquiring several competitors between 1948 and 1967. Just a few years into trading, it released its earliest pieces of furniturea golden oak desk and bookcase with utilitarian lines and subtle Art Nouveau influence.
